Package: tntnet (3.0-4)
Links for tntnet
Debian Resources:
Download Source Package tntnet:
Maintainer:
External Resources:
- Homepage [www.tntnet.org]
Similar packages:
Modulær netprogramserver med flere tråde for C++
Tntnet har et skabelonsprog kaldt ecpp svarende til PHP, JSP eller Mason, hvor du kan indlejre C++-kode i en HTML-side for at oprette aktivt indhold. Ecpp-filerne er forhåndskompileret til C++-klasser kaldt for komponenter og kompileret og lænket i et delt bibliotek. Denne proces udføres på kompileringstidspunktet. Internetserveren Tntnet kræver kun det kompilerede komponentbibliotek.
Da internetprogrammer kompileres til standardkode, så er de meget hurtige og kompakte.
Komponenter kan kalde andre komponenter. Så du kan oprette byggeblokke med HTML-dele og kalde dem i andre sider ligesom underprocesser.
Forespørgsler fortolkes af tntnet og forespørgselsinformationen kan nemt tilgås af komponenterne. Programmet understøtter GET- og POST-parametre og MIME multipart-forespørgsler for filoverførsler.
Skabelonsproget har også understøttelse for internationale programmer. Du kan nemt oprette internetprogrammer for forskellige sprog.
Andre funktioner er: cookier, HTTP-overførsel, forespørg automatisk efter parameterfortolkning og konvertering, automatisk sessionshåndtering, afgrænsede variabler (anvendelse, forespørgsel og session), oversættelse og hold-i-live.
Logning udføres igennem cxxtools, som tilbyder en unik API for log4cpp, log4cxx eller simpel logning til filer eller konsol.
Tntnet kan bruge flere tråde og et stort arbejde er brugt på at gøre programmet skalerbart. Programmet bruger en dynamisk pool af arbejdstråde, som svarer på forespørgsler fra HTTP-klienter.
Denne pakke indeholder serveren.
Other Packages Related to tntnet
|
|
|
|
-
- dep: init-system-helpers (>= 1.54~)
- Hjælpeværktøjer for alle init-systemer
-
- dep: libc6 (>= 2.34)
- GNU C-bibliotek: Delte biblioteker
also a virtual package provided by libc6-udeb
-
- dep: libcxxtools10 (>= 3.0.0)
- library of unrelated but useful C++ classes (library)
-
- dep: libgcc-s1 (>= 3.0)
- GCC støttebibliotek
-
- dep: libstdc++6 (>= 13.1)
- GNU Standard C++ bibliotek v3
-
- dep: libtntnet13t64 (>= 3.0)
- Tntnet libraries
-
- dep: net-tools
- Netværksværktøjssættet NET-3
-
- dep: tntnet-runtime (= 3.0-4)
- Tntnet-kørselstidssystem
-
- sug: libtntnet-dev
- Tntnet library development headers
-
- sug: tntnet-doc
- Dokumentation for Tntnet
Download tntnet
Architecture | Package Size | Installed Size | Files |
---|---|---|---|
riscv64 | 80.4 kB | 198.0 kB | [list of files] |